How do I keep my baby safe in the water?

  1. Make sure the pool is warm enough.
  2. As soon as your baby starts to shiver, get him out of the pool and wrap him up warmly.
  3. Start off with sessions of 10 minutes and build up to 20 minutes.
  4. If your baby has a bad cold, a temperature or seems unwell, don’t go swimming .

Can newborns swim?

It is not true that babies are born with the ability to swim, though they have primitive reflexes that make it look like they are. Babies are not old enough to hold their breath intentionally or strong enough to keep their head above water, and cannot swim unassisted.

Can a 1 month old go swimming?

Most physicians recommend waiting until the baby is at least 6 months of age before going swimming with your baby. If your baby is less than six months old, avoid taking him or her to a large public pool, as the water is too cold.

When can babies start swimming lessons?

It’s important to know that newborns and infants younger than 12 months old aren’t yet able to raise their heads above the water to breathe, so swimming lessons aren’t yet appropriate for them. In your baby’s first year, you might like to do parent-child water play classes with your baby to help him get used to being in water.

Is it safe for young children to learn to swim?

One 2017 report from the UK argued the practice was traumatic to young brains, while the American Academy of Pediatrics (AAP) said in 2000 there was no data to show whether such programs affected the risk of drowning. The AAP did say last year, though, that any child over 1 should learn to swim.
